on 9/26/02 10:12 AM, Pablo Roufogalis L. at email@hidden wrote:

> I change the profile used by CS and see changes in the way the image is
> shown in Picture Viewer?

You are likely seeing the LUT in the profile updating which is a bit
different than how ICC savvy applications deal with the display profile and
the embedded profile in a file. But anyway, when you do this (load a
different profile) do you see the problems in the image (either IN Photoshop
or Picture Viewer)? If not, then the root of the problem seems to be the
display profile you made.
